header{
    display:block;
    background-color: #ffffff;
}
#header{
    font-family:Arial;
    display:block;
    padding:0; 
    margin:0;
    max-height:60px;
    max-width:100%;
    background-color: #ffffff;
}

#header #header-noaa{float:left; max-width:7.0%;}
#header #header-nws{float:left; max-width:75.3%;}
#header #header-doc{float:right; max-width:17.7%;}

#header h1{
    font-size:3vw;
    font-weight:500;
    letter-spacing: -1px;
    text-transform: uppercase;
    margin: 8px 0 0 40px;
    color:#000;
}
#header h5{
    font-size:.9vw;
    font-weight:600;
    text-transform: uppercase; 
    letter-spacing: 5px;
    margin: -2px 0 8px 40px;
    color:#999; 
}
@media screen and (min-width:1188px){
    #header h1{
        font-size:35.6px;
        margin-left:40px;
    }
    #header h5{
        font-size:11px; 
        letter-spacing: 5px;
        margin-left:40px;
    }
}
@media screen and (max-width:900px){
    #header h5{
        font-size:10px;
        letter-spacing: 3px;
    }
}
@media screen and (max-width:680px){

    #header h1{
        font-size:22px;
        font-weight:500;
        margin-left:2vw;
    }
    #header h5{
        font-size:9px;
        letter-spacing: 1.3px;
        font-weight:600;
        margin-left:2vw;
    }
}

#header a{ max-height:100%; padding:0; margin:0;}
#header a img {width:100%; text-decoration:none; vertical-align:middle;}

